Eleanor Odermatt
NPI: 1205486602
Eleanor Odermatt is a Licensed Clinical Social Worker specialist focused health provider in Chowchilla, California. affiliates with no hospitals or medical groups. Call Eleanor Odermatt on phone number 5596656100 for more information and advice or to book an appointment.
City | Chowchilla |
State | California |
Address 1 | 21633 AVENUE 24 |
Postal Code | 93610 |
Phone | 5596656100 |
Primary Specialty | Licensed Clinical Social Worker |